Thaddeus was struck with an epiphany. "I get it now. You're saying someone's ordering Soraya Tisdale to do this, and what we need to do now is draw out that person."

Elspeth smiled and gave the doctor a thumbs-up. "Exactly! You catch on quickly. However, no one can know about this just yet. I don't know if I can trust you."

Thaddeus wiped the sweat off his forehead as he looked at Elspeth's piercing gaze. "Rest assured, Miss Lynwood. My lips are sealed. No one else will know about this."

At that, Elspeth withdrew her gaze, satisfied. "That's good to hear. Only you, me, and your disciples should know about this. No one else should find out."

"That goes without a saying."

With everything said, Elspeth was reminded that she was supposed to bring Yelena her food. With that, she walked to the door, grabbed the bag from the table, and went to deliver Yelena her food.

As Harper had been busy with laboratory work, Elspeth didn't hand over the investigation to him. Therefore, Callum took the initiative to investigate the matter.

He acted swiftly, too, as he dug up the nurse's complete background and recent activities in just two days. He even had detailed information on her phone calls and chat conversations.

In the hospital garden, Elspeth looked at the information Callum shared with her and felt increasingly heavy-hearted. "So, Alphascape is behind this, or should I say Yena Hallaway is behind this."

Callum nodded. "And if my guess is correct, Yena probably lured Soraya into it with bribes of sorts."

However, Elspeth couldn't quite understand how it came about.

"But almost the entire hospital knows that Yelena is our experimental subject for the new drug now. If we abruptly interrupt the plan, the release of the new drug will undoubtedly be delayed, which won't benefit other patients."

"Soraya is Yelena's personal nurse. She must be aware of this. So why would she make such a risky, suicidal action?"

Callum agreed with her, too, to some extent. "You're right. After all, Soraya's parents are also infected with the virus from this outbreak and are in critical condition."
